Buying Guide

  • Fit and layering: Pick a jacket with a snug but comfortable fit to reduce wind intrusion. If you ride aggressively, consider a close-to-body cut (as Castelli notes) and plan for mid-layers in colder conditions.
  • Weather protection: Distinguish between windproof and waterproof capabilities. For dry, windy days, a windproof shell is often sufficient; for misty or wetter days, look for water resistance or a waterproof membrane as seen in Baleaf and ARSUXEO jackets.
  • Insulation and warmth: Three-layer systems, fleece linings, and brushed interiors add warmth. Decide whether you need a lightweight shell with a mid-layer option or a fully insulated piece for harsh mornings.
  • Pockets and storage: Number and placement of pockets affect ride efficiency. Uplifting with chest pockets and rear cargo pockets helps store gloves, nutrition, and tools without hindering movement.
  • Visibility and reflectivity: Reflective elements on chest, sleeves, and back improve safety during dawn, dusk, or nighttime riding. This is a critical factor for urban and rural routes alike.
  • Breathability and venting: Look for vented chest zippers or breathable membranes to manage sweat during climbs. Proper venting prevents overheating on high-effort segments.
  • Durability and materials: Softshell and ripstop fabrics offer durability and resistance to abrasion. Consider stitching quality and zippers designed for cycling in gloves.
  • Sizing and fit guidance: Some brands run small or tight (as noted by Castelli). If between sizes, size up for comfort during long rides or heavier mid-layers.
  • Price versus value: Premium jackets from Castelli provide performance-focused features and fit, while Baleaf and ARSUXEO offer strong warmth-to-price ratios for riders on a budget.
  • Care and maintenance: Follow washing and drying instructions to preserve waterproofing and insulation. Reproofing or occasional re-treatment may extend the life of water-repellent finishes.

Riding choices vary by climate and style. For early-season road training, a windproof, moderately insulated shell with reflective details may be sufficient. For deep-winter commutes or long rides in freezing wind, layering with a waterproof membrane or a dedicated insulated jacket often yields the most consistent warmth.
